MSIL/Generic.BT!tr.bdr
Analysis
MSIL/Generic.BT!tr.bdr is classified as a backdoor trojan.
A backdoor trojan is a type of malware that enables a remote user to have unauthorized access to the infected computer. Common backdoor capabilities include capturing keyboard input, collecting system information, downloading/uploading files, performing denial-of-service (DoS) attacks, and running/terminating processes.
